What is a Wet Belt in the Ford Transit Custom EcoBoost?
A wet belt in the Ford Transit Custom EcoBoost is a timing belt that operates whilst submerged in engine oil, controlling the precise timing of valve operations and other critical engine functions. Unlike traditional dry timing belts that run in a sealed chamber separate from engine fluids, wet belts are deliberately designed to run in an oil-rich environment for improved lubrication and quieter operation.
The ford transit custom 1.0 ecoboost wet belt system was introduced to reduce noise, vibration, and harshness whilst maintaining precise timing control. However, this design creates unique challenges as the belt material must withstand constant exposure to hot engine oil, temperature fluctuations, and the chemical changes that occur as oil degrades over time.
The critical difference lies in how these belts fail. Whilst a dry timing belt typically shows visible wear or fraying before complete failure, wet belts can degrade internally due to oil contamination, chemical breakdown, or moisture ingress. This makes early detection more challenging, as the warning signs are often subtle and related to engine performance rather than visible belt condition.
- Operates submerged in engine oil for lubrication and noise reduction
- Controls timing of valves and auxiliary components
- More susceptible to chemical degradation than dry belts
- Failure signs are often performance-related rather than visual
Ford implemented wet belt technology in EcoBoost engines to reduce manufacturing costs, improve fuel efficiency, and decrease cabin noise. The oil lubrication allows for tighter tolerances and smoother operation, but requires more careful maintenance to prevent premature failure.
4 Signs of Ford Transit Custom EcoBoost Wet Belt Problems
Recognising the early signs of ford transit custom ecoboost wet belt problems can save you thousands in repair costs and prevent dangerous roadside breakdowns. These four warning signs often appear gradually, making regular monitoring essential for UK drivers who rely on their Transit Custom for daily operations.
The first and most concerning sign is coolant loss without visible external leaks. When wet belts begin to degrade, they can compromise seals and gaskets in the cooling system, leading to internal coolant loss that doesn’t leave puddles under your van but gradually lowers coolant levels. This is particularly dangerous as it can lead to overheating without obvious warning.
Sudden engine misfires under load represent the second critical warning sign. As the wet belt stretches or degrades, timing becomes erratic, causing the engine to misfire during acceleration or when climbing hills. UK drivers often first notice this when merging onto motorways or navigating steep country roads with a loaded van.
The third sign involves ecoboost oil dilution transit custom, where fuel or coolant contaminates the engine oil due to compromised seals or timing issues. You might notice the oil level rising unexpectedly, a milky appearance to the oil, or an unusual smell when checking the dipstick. This contamination accelerates engine wear and can lead to catastrophic failure if ignored.
- Coolant loss without visible external leaks – check levels weekly
- Engine misfires under load, especially during acceleration or hill climbing
- Oil dilution – rising oil levels, milky appearance, or unusual odours
- Unusual noises on cold starts – rattling or grinding sounds from the engine bay

Diagnostics and Professional Assessment for Wet Belt Issues
Professional diagnostics for ford transit custom ecoboost wet belt problems involve a systematic approach that goes far beyond basic visual inspection. UK engine specialists use sophisticated diagnostic equipment to assess belt condition, timing accuracy, and related engine health without dismantling the engine unnecessarily.
The diagnostic process typically begins with ECU data analysis, examining fault codes, timing parameters, and sensor readings to identify timing-related issues. Compression tests across all cylinders reveal whether valve timing problems have caused internal damage, whilst oil analysis can detect contamination levels and unusual wear particles that indicate belt degradation.
Cooling system pressure tests are crucial for identifying internal coolant leaks that suggest wet belt seal compromise. Professional technicians also perform leak-down tests to assess valve sealing and may use borescope inspection to examine internal engine condition without complete disassembly. This comprehensive approach ensures accurate diagnosis and appropriate repair recommendations.
Timing should be professionally assessed when symptoms first appear, as early intervention significantly reduces repair costs. UK drivers should seek specialist assessment immediately if multiple symptoms occur simultaneously, as this often indicates advanced belt degradation requiring urgent attention.
- ECU data analysis for timing and sensor parameters
- Compression and leak-down testing across all cylinders
- Oil analysis to detect contamination and wear particles
- Cooling system pressure tests for internal leak detection
- Borescope inspection of internal engine condition

Costs, Repairs, and Prevention: Protecting Your Engine
Understanding the financial implications of ford transit custom ecoboost wet belt problems helps UK business owners make informed decisions about maintenance and repair timing. Early intervention typically costs significantly less than waiting until complete belt failure, which can cause catastrophic engine damage requiring full replacement or extensive reconditioning.
Preventive wet belt replacement, when performed before failure, generally represents the most cost-effective approach. However, if belt degradation has caused timing issues or internal damage, wet belt to chain conversion cost becomes a consideration for long-term reliability. Chain conversion eliminates future wet belt concerns but requires more extensive engine work.
Ford engine reconditioning transit custom becomes necessary when belt failure has caused valve damage, bearing wear, or cylinder scoring. Professional reconditioning can restore engine performance whilst being more economical than complete replacement, but costs increase significantly with the extent of internal damage discovered during assessment.
For UK fleet operators, the cost of downtime often exceeds repair costs, making preventive maintenance and early intervention crucial business decisions. Regular monitoring and scheduled belt replacement prevent the unexpected failures that can sideline vehicles during peak business periods.
- Preventive replacement: most cost-effective when performed early
- Chain conversion: higher initial cost but eliminates future wet belt issues
- Engine reconditioning: necessary when internal damage has occurred
- Downtime costs often exceed repair expenses for commercial operators

Maintenance Tips to Prevent Ford Transit Custom Wet Belt Problems
Preventing ford transit custom ecoboost wet belt problems requires a proactive maintenance approach tailored to UK driving conditions, where frequent stop-start traffic, variable weather, and demanding delivery schedules put additional stress on wet belt systems.
Regular oil changes using manufacturer-specified grades become critical for wet belt longevity, as the belt operates directly in this oil environment. UK drivers should adhere strictly to service intervals, with consideration for more frequent changes if operating in severe conditions such as constant urban delivery work or dusty environments common in construction and agricultural applications.
Coolant system maintenance deserves particular attention, as contaminated or degraded coolant can affect seals and gaskets that protect wet belt components. Regular coolant level monitoring, system flushes at recommended intervals, and prompt attention to any cooling system issues help prevent the seal failures that often accompany wet belt degradation.
Temperature monitoring during operation helps identify developing issues before they become serious. UK drivers should be alert to temperature gauge changes, especially during extended motorway driving or when operating with heavy loads, as overheating can accelerate wet belt deterioration and related component failure.
- Follow manufacturer service intervals religiously, consider shorter intervals for severe use
- Use only specified oil grades and change filters as recommended
- Monitor coolant levels weekly and maintain system cleanliness
- Watch temperature gauge during operation, especially under load
- Schedule professional belt inspections at major service intervals
UK driving conditions including frequent cold starts, short urban journeys, and variable weather place additional stress on wet belt systems. Consider more frequent oil analysis if operating in demanding conditions such as constant stop-start delivery work.
